- a HEAVY GALVANIZED STEEL or aluminum tube that looks like the galvanized steel pipe used for plumbing applications, except it is much smoother and is labeled with a UL Listed stamp or label has THREADED connections much like a pipe
- can be used in contact with the earth and embedded in concrete
RIGID METAL CONDUIT
• galvanized steel or aluminum tube that has a thinner wall than rigid metal conduit
• has threaded connections much like pipe or threadless connectors and couplings
• can be used in contact with earth and embedded in concrete
INTERMEDIATE METAL CONDUIT
• THIN _ WALLED GALVANIZED STEEL or aluminum tube in nominal diameters up to 4 in.
• CANNOT BE THREADED
• labeled with UL Listed stamp or label
• joined with threadless compression couplings, couplings that are crimped into the tubing with a special indenting tool, or fittings that are TIGHTENED WITH SCREWS
ELECTRICAL METALLIC TUBING

• is of a standardized, factory assembled enclosure consisting of outer DUCT LIKE HOUSING, BUS BARS, and INSULATORS
•__________ systems are used in service equipment or as __________ because they are designed to carry a large amount of current
BUSWAY, feeders
A type of busway system that used to deliver a LARGE AMOUNT OF POWER with LOW VOLTAGE DROP • available in sizes from 600 A to several thousand amps
FEEDER BUSWAY
• Another type of busway system used to provide POWER TAP-OFFS at multiple points • available in 100 A- 3000 A sizes
PLUG-IN-BUSWAY
